Greetings from the critique club

First Impression:
Composition is busy, uncomfortable tilt in the horizon.

Relevance to the challenge:
I see you were trying to contrast the yellow flowers to the blue sky, which is a good idea. It might have helped to boost the yellow saturation to make it stand out more

Composition:
You could've got a nice yellow-blue contrast with a much tighter crop. The trees behind the flowers dont seem to add much to the photograph.

Camera work:
The depth of field appears too deep. A smaller aperture would have been sufficient.

Processing:
The colors are a bit on the dull side. Boosting the saturation woul've helped.

Good luck in future challenges!
